121:7.2 The teachings and practices of Jesus regarding tolerance and kindness ran counter to the long-standing attitude of the Jews toward other peoples whom they considered heathen. For generations the Jews had nourished an attitude toward the outside world which made it impossible for them to accept the Master’s teachings about the spiritual brotherhood of man. They were unwilling to share Yahweh on equal terms with the gentiles and were likewise unwilling to accept as the Son of God one who taught such new and strange doctrines.

Be Kind

The sun is out, we’ll hit 50.

The day before us is nifty.

There’s always much that can be done

Before the setting of the sun.

What to do on this fine day?

Too muddy for groundwork today.

But temps are nice, we can enjoy

Fresh air, with windows we employ.

Open up the house today.

Screens keep bugs and flies away.

we get the air, and it feels fresh.

We know this day we’ll find success.

We’re going to plan and then complete

A way to make this day replete.

Balance my activities.

Make life of joy for all to see.

Try to be of help when out.

Take your time and stay about

The Father’s Business on your route.

What e’er comes up, just sing don’t pout.

Stay upon a route that’s kind.

Don’t worry about falling behind.

Do the best in front of you!

And things work out when this you do.

Thank You, Father, for the day.

I’ll do my best to go Your way.

On my route while I’m at play,

Kindness will be on display!
